Aminuddin Expresses Satisfaction with Negeri Sembilan Councillors’ Performance

Negeri Sembilan: Negeri Sembilan Menteri Besar Datuk Seri Aminuddin Harun has expressed satisfaction with the work performance of his executive councillors as they enter their second year of administration following the previous State Election. All ten councillors have reportedly fulfilled their responsibilities effectively, surpassing the stipulated key performance indicators (KPI).

According to BERNAMA News Agency, Aminuddin remarked that while some councillors are new, all have demonstrated an understanding of their responsibilities. He acknowledged minor shortcomings in the first year but noted significant improvements in the second year. Aminuddin emphasized that there are no plans to alter the current executive council lineup, as stability is crucial for effective planning. He stressed the importance of continuous improvement, which is consistently communicated to the councillors.

In addition to evaluating the performance of councillors, Aminuddin announced the upcoming launch of the Palestine Wakaf Fund this Ramadan. The initiative aims to collect RM4 million in public contributions to support the people of Gaza. The state government, in collaboration with the Negeri Sembilan Islamic Religious Council and the Malaysian Consultative Council of Islamic Organisation, is committed to constructing houses for Palestinians in Gaza, as part of their preparation efforts.
